Cost of business leadership coaching in Australia

Pricing can feel like a minefield at times, but understanding general benchmarks across Australian cities helps shape expectations. In Sydney, Melbourne, or Perth, rates for skilled leadership coaches usually range from $250 to upwards of $700 per hour, depending on experience and coaching format. 

At Y Coaching, programs are priced based on scope, ranging from one-on-one sessions to longer strategic consulting packages. Executive-focused coaching like Conrad Morgan’s lies on the top end, but the returns in decision-making and business clarity often justify that investment several times over. 

Compared to once-off workshops or broad leadership courses, personalised coaching creates a deeper connection with real business issues. That’s what sets this investment apart – it’s not generic, and it moves with your business rather than outside of it.

Advantages and limitations

The strength of coaching lies in how personal and adaptable it is. Sessions with leaders like Conrad Morgan bring in high-level vision while remaining grounded in real-world execution. 

That said, success depends on two things: coach fit and leader engagement. If either side is out of sync, results may be limited. Coaching isn’t something you impose; it needs buy-in.
